Title: 204SOM Clock on connector option
Post by: moris on December 06, 2017, 08:32:18 AM
Some systems may require that SOM's get an external clock.
Leading a clock trace and a appropriate Gnd from the 204-connector to the SoC over an 0R-resistor would allow for this option.
For small quantities the crystal (and caps) on the standard board version could be desoldered and the 0R-resistor be soldered.
